Accounting for VAT on fuel private usage

HMRC publish annually the scale rates to be used to account for VAT where VAT is reclaimed in full on fuel but there is a private element to the motoring costs.

The rates to be used from 1 May 2023 were released on 21 April 2023 and the link is shown below.

The VAT amount is determined by the CO2 banding of the vehicle. So for a vehicle with 150g emissions, the amount to pay back is 61.33 per quarter.

Is claiming VAT on fuel worthwhile? You cannot pick and choose which vehicles it applies to.
